Will Ferrell was, at one point, about as big of a star as one can hope to find in the world of comedy.

Following his legendary stint on “Saturday Night Live,” the actor had great success in movies such as “Anchorman” and “Step Brothers” in the first decade of the 2000s.

But in 2008, Ferrell led an all-star cast that also included the likes of Woody Harrelson, Andre 3000, Will Arnett, and many other famous comedy faces that audiences know and love in a basketball comedy called “Semi-Pro.” It was a movie with all the talent in the world which, unfortunately, didn’t quite live up to expectations at the time of its release.While the film topped the box office on its opening weekend back in March of 2008, it topped out at $44 million worldwide against a reported budget of $55 million.

Critics also were not terribly kind to the sports comedy at the time.
